El-Rufa’i spotted at SDP HQ with politicians days after denying defection rumours

Former Governor of Kaduna State, Nasir Ahmed el-Rufa’i has sparked speculation about his political future with a visit to the Social Democratic Party (SDP) national headquarters yesterday.

This move came just two days after he denied rumours of defecting from the ruling All Progressives Congress (APC) to the opposition Peoples Democratic Party (PDP).

A post shared on Facebook by Liberty TV/Radio Chairman Kaduna and former Chairman of the Nigerian Maritime Administration and Safety Agency (NIMASA) Board,  Alhaji (Dr.) Ahmed Tijjani Ramalan, revealed el-Rufa’i meeting with other prominent politicians at the SDP office yesterday.

Ahmed, who posted photographs of the visit, said the meeting was held over plots to form a unified political platform that will unseat the ruling APC in the 2027 general election.

Ahmed wrote: “At the Social Democratic Party (SDP) National Headquarters today are Nasuru el-Rufa’i, Major Hamza al-Mustapha (rtd), Segun Showunmi, Senator Gada, and other political actors gathering looking for a unified platform for the 2027 Presidential battle”.

Recall that el-Rufa’i had taken to social media platform X on Sunday to debunk the defection claims, threatening legal action against those responsible for spreading the false information.

“Please disregard the patent lies and rumours about my political affiliation. I have referred the lead peddlers of the fake news for further action by my lawyers,” he wrote.

Recall also, that in March 2024, el-Rufa’i made a similar visit to the SDP office in Abuja. However, according to his spokesperson, Muyiwa Adekeye, following last year’s visit, it was merely a courtesy call in response to a prior visit from the party’s chairman, Shehu Musa Gabam.

El-Rufai’s team emphasised that the visit didn’t indicate any impending political move.
